How to prepare for a job interview at Academics

✨Know Your Curriculum

Familiarise yourself with the English curriculum relevant to the age group you'll be teaching. Be ready to discuss how you would approach different topics and engage students in literature and writing.

✨Showcase Your Passion

During the interview, let your enthusiasm for teaching shine through. Share personal anecdotes or experiences that highlight your love for English and how it inspires your teaching style.

✨Prepare for Classroom Scenarios

Expect to be asked about classroom management and lesson planning. Think of specific examples where you've successfully handled challenges or created engaging lessons that catered to diverse learning needs.

✨Ask Insightful Questions

At the end of the interview, have a few thoughtful questions prepared. Inquire about the school's teaching philosophy, support for professional development, or how they foster a positive learning environment.
